    Hey Nick,
    I was wondering if you could help me with something. I have a 2000 Suzuki Grand Vitara, with the original 2.5L V6, 3sp with .O.D. trans. and supposedly 4.88 factory geared rearend. I was thinking about converting to carbureted Chevy V8, but using the original trans. If I were able to find an adapter to match the V8-engine to the original trans (03-72LE, A44DE)...would the trans be able to function without the original engine in place? Or does the trans work hand-in-hand with it? I thought about putting an earlier GM-non-electronic trans (THM350), but with the 4.88 rear gear, it would be pulling ridiculous RPM on the freeway. On top of that, the original speedometer in the Grand Vitara doesn't have the typical screw-in speedo cable, and that is actually my MAIN concern, which is keeping me from going forward with this (that's why I was hoping to use the original trans).
